Broadband and high-efficient aperture antenna / array covered with a superstrate layer at 60 GHz is investigated. Adding a superstrate layer with a specific size will induce a significant effect on antenna performances. A high-efficient and high-gain aperture coupled patch antenna with superstrate at 60 GHz is studied and presented. It is noted that adding superstrate will result in a significant effect on the antenna performances, and the size of the superstrate is critical for the optimum performance.
